U.S. Blew Up a C.I.A. Write-up Made use of to Evacuate At-Risk Afghans

A controlled detonation by American forces that was heard during Kabul has ruined Eagle Foundation, the last C.I.A. outpost outside the Kabul airport, U.S. officials claimed on Friday.

Blowing up the foundation was intended to make certain that any equipment or info left powering would not tumble into the palms of the Taliban.

Eagle Foundation, initially commenced early in the war at a former brick manufacturing unit, experienced been utilised all over the conflict. It grew from a little outpost to a sprawling centre that was used to practice the counterterrorism forces of Afghanistan’s intelligence businesses.

Those forces ended up some of the only types to keep battling as the federal government collapsed, according to existing and previous officials.

“They had been an remarkable unit,” stated Mick Mulroy, a previous C.I.A. officer who served in Afghanistan. “They were being one particular of the most important usually means the Afghan government has utilised to preserve the Taliban at bay more than the very last 20 a long time. They ended up the final types fighting, and they took weighty casualties.”

Area Afghans knew minimal about the foundation. The compound was extremely safe and designed to be all but unattainable to penetrate. Partitions reaching 10 ft higher surrounded the website, and a thick metallic gate slid open and shut quickly to permit vehicles inside of.

After inside of, cars and trucks nevertheless experienced to very clear three outer security checkpoints where by the autos would be searched and paperwork would be screened right before currently being authorized inside the foundation.

In the early several years of the war, a junior C.I.A. officer was place in charge of the Salt Pit, a detention web-site in close proximity to Eagle Base. There the officer requested a prisoner, Gul Rahman, stripped of his clothing and shackled to a wall. He died of hypothermia. A C.I.A. board advised disciplinary action but was overruled.

A former C.I.A. contractor mentioned that leveling the foundation would have been no simple activity. In addition to burning paperwork and crushing really hard drives, sensitive equipment desired to be ruined so it did not drop into the arms of the Taliban. Eagle Base, the former contractor stated, was not like an embassy in which files could be quickly burned.

The base’s destruction experienced been prepared and was not linked to the enormous explosion at the airport that killed an estimated 170 Afghans and 13 American support users. But the detonation, hrs immediately after the airport assault, alarmed quite a few men and women in Kabul, who feared that it was a different terrorist bombing.

The official American mission in Afghanistan to evacuate U.S. citizens and Afghan allies is set to close next Tuesday. The Taliban have stated that the evacuation hard work should not be prolonged, and Biden administration officials say that continuing previous that date would appreciably enhance the challenges to both equally Afghans and U.S. troops.
